#32457e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#32457e is composed of 19.6% red, 27.1%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.3% cyan, 45.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 225 degrees, a saturation of 43.2% and a lightness of 34.5%. #32457e color hex could be obtained by blending #648afc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#32457e color description : Dark moderate blue.
#32457e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#32457e has RGB values of R:50, G:69, B:126 and CMYK values of C:0.6, M:0.45, Y:0,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 3294590.

Shades and Tints of #32457e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05070e is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#32457e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#54565c is the less saturated color, while #032dad is the most saturated one.
